Anglia Lighting Distributing Carclo Optics Products

Anglia expands range of LED lighting accessories by signing Carclo Optics

Anglia has announced that it has expanded the range of optics offered by its Anglia Lighting division by signing a UK and Ireland distribution agreement with optics manufacturer Carclo.

Carclo Optics manufactures a range of standard and custom optics products for use with LEDs and other solid state devices: these include high efficiency collimator lenses for use with LED lighting and laser diodes, display light-guides for LED matrices, and polyethylene PIR lenses.

New Rail-Industry Connectors Ordering Guide

New ordering guide focuses on rail-industry connectors

New ordering guide focuses on rail-industry connectorsFranchised assembling distributor PEI-Genesis has brought out a new ordering guide for the CIR series of rail-industry connectors manufactured by ITT Interconnect Solutions (Cannon and VEAM).

Specifically designed for the hostile environment of rail and mass-transit applications, the versatile CIR series is available in an enormous range of styles, sizes and configurations.

PEI-Genesis holds stock at piece-part level and, within 48 hours of receiving an order, assembles the connectors to meet the customer’s exact requirements.

The new 28-page guide serves as a handy quick-reference tool for creating a part number, with connector variants listed by both shell size and number of contacts to make it easier for customers to specify the right connector for their application.

The guide also includes key technical specifications, line diagrams of the various shell styles, and a section detailing the comprehensive range of crimp contact assembly tools available for the CIR series connectors.

Mouser Now Stocking TriQuint New Amplifiers

Mouser Electronics Now Stocking TriQuint-WJ’s New WJA Family Gain Block Amplifiers for Broadband Applications

TriQuint-WJ’s New WJA Family Gain Block Amplifiers for Broadband ApplicationsMouser Electronics, Inc., known for its rapid introduction of the newest products, today announced it is now stocking WJ Communication’s WJA1001 and WJA1021 – the latest additions to their +5V Active Bias General Purpose Gain Block amplifier series. WJ Communications, Inc, recently acquired by TriQuint Semiconductor, is a leading supplier of radio frequency (RF) products and solutions for the wireless infrastructure and radio frequency identification (RFID) reader markets.

The WJA high-performance broadband amplifiers provide an excellent mix of power gain, linearity, and supply current performance in a SOT-89 package, enabling designers to integrate with their designs. The devices are internally matched to 50 ohm and only require DC-blocking/bypass capacitors and a bias inductor for operation. The amplifiers utilize the high-reliability InGaP/GaAs HBT process technology and are suitable for current and next generation wireless applications such as GSM, PCS, CDMA, W-CDMA, WiBro and WiMax, Repeaters, BTS Transceivers, and RFID.

The WJA1001 has been optimized to offer industry-leading linearity performance and provides 19dB gain at 900MHz, a +20dBm 1-dB compression point, and +45dBm OIP3 at 900MHz, while drawing only 100mA of current from a 5V supply voltage.

The WJA1021 gain block amplifier offers +37.5dBm OIP3 at 1.9GHz and is ideal for high linearity applications in the 50 to 4000MHz frequency range. At 1.9GHz, the device typically provides 17.5dB gain, +37.5dBm OIP3, and19dBm P1dB, drawing only 90mA current from a 5V supply.
